The California Flooring and Floor Covering (C-15) contractor license allows you to prepare any surface for the installation of flooring and floor coverings, and install carpet, resilient sheet goods, resilient tile, wood floors and flooring (including the finishing and repairing thereof), and any other materials established as flooring and floor covering material, except ceramic tile.
